Log message:
	Test with -F flag
	
	grep need -F to check what we really want to test.
	Add better test for existing device.
	
	Currently this test DOES NOT work with real /dev handle via udev
	since our tool does not see such device listet through udev.
	
	FIXME: We might be able to see it at least through dmsetup table and
	use for lvm.
